Breath test–proven malabsorption does not reliably predict symptoms. Many patients without malabsorption still develop significant symptoms. Symptoms after lactose ingestion are linked to fructose sensitivity and functional GI disorders. Validated, test‐specific symptom assessment is required to identify patients who may benefit from treatment ...

Plastid Engineering for Photosynthesis‐Driven Synthesis of Hyaluronic Acid in Tobacco
ABSTRACT Hyaluronic acid (HA) is a glycosaminoglycan composed of alternating units of N‐acetylglucosamine and glucuronic acid. High moisture retention, viscoelasticity and biocompatibility are unique features that make HA polymers attractive compounds for medical applications and aesthetic purposes.
